If this is your first anemone, I would suggest either a RBTA or regular BTA, as they are the hardiest. Ocellaris often go into them as well.
 
Ok, I like the rbta. Will do some more research on them see if I can handle one=) This will be my first anemone so I hope it goes well.
 
They are quite hardy. T-5 lighting would be great for a RBTA. You might want to go to Karen's Rose Anemones, a website all about RBTAs.
